Title: Abelian reductions and internality to the constants.

Abstract: I will report on joint work with Remi Jaoui on the structure of finite rank types in differentially closed fields. Given a type p that is internal and weakly orthogonal to the constants, we introduce and study its “abelian reduction”, namely an image q of p such that the binding group of q is the abelian part in the Chevalley decomposition of the binding group of p. I will discuss a number of applications of this new tool, including the following result: If a type over constant parameters is nonorthogonal to the constants then its second Morley power is not weakly orthogonal to the constants.
